The “Great Reset” agenda was brought into existence by the World Economic Forum, or “WEF”, in summer 2020. Some of its main building blocks, such as “stakeholder capitalism” have been around for decades. Discussion on it got into gear when a video by a Danish politician Ida Auken was posted on the WEF website in 2016 (later removed) which laid out a dystopian economic future where “You’ll own nothing. And you’ll be happy”.

What is the Great Reset?

Effectively, Great Reset is a collection of vaguely stated measures to transfer power from democratically elected governments to multinational corporations and supra-national entities. It aims to do it through three main components:

  • Governments would steer the market towards “fairer outcomes” using taxation, regulatory and fiscal policies, including wealth taxes and removal of fossil-fuel subsidies, and impose a new set of rules governing intellectual property, trade and competition.
  • Ensure that investments advance “shared goals”, like equitability and sustainability, through government led large-scale investment programs, like the Recovery Fund of the EU (and the infrastructure bill of the U.S.).
  • To “harness” the innovations of the so called Fourth Industrial Revolution to address health and social challenges.

The Great Economic Takeover

The foundation of this scenario is something we have been warning about for some time: the takeover of the economy by the central banks through their digital currencies, or CBDCs (see, e.g., this and this). However, GR would add a worrying dimension.

The main idea of CBDCs can be summarized as everyone having an account at the central bank. It would provide superior safety during banking crises, which would mean that CBDCs would lead to the concentration of deposits at a central bank in a financial crisis, which tend to occur semi-regularly. After the central bank has effectively absorbed the private banking system, it would be run by the current hierarchy of overtly-politicized central bankers.
